New Procedure for Measuring the Connecting Rod {1218, 1225}

  • A new procedure for measuring the connecting rod is now used in order to compensate for the shifting of the connecting rod cap. The connecting rod must be tightened with the following procedure.

    Note: Bolts A and B are on the same end of the rod cap that has bearing tabs and location pin (1) .

    1. Before assembly, put 6V-4876 Lubricant on the bolt threads and all surfaces that make contact between the bolt and the cap.

    1. Tighten bolts A and B.

      Torque ... 90 ± 5 N·m (65 ± 4 lb ft)

    1. Tighten bolts C and D.

      Torque ... 90 ± 5 N·m (65 ± 4 lb ft)

    1. Tighten bolts C and D again.

      Torque ... 90 ± 5 N·m (65 ± 4 lb ft)

    1. Tighten each bolt again.

      Rotation ... 90 ± 5 degrees

    The connecting rod must be measured in three places. Measure diameter (2). The diameter should be 143.028 ± 0.015 mm (5.6310 ± 0.0006 inch).

    Note: This procedure only applies to new connecting rods.

    Measure diameter (3) and diameter (4). Add diameter (3) and diameter (4) together. Divide the sum by two. This calculation must also be 143.028 ± 0.015 mm (5.6310 ± 0.0006 inch). If the measurements do not meet the specification, replace the connecting rod after verifying that the tightening procedure is correct.
